If the engine has B16A1 or B16A2 stamp it will be what you want.
The early B16A1 are suppose to have 150bhp but I have seen conflicting info about this on the net, I'm pretty sure a 94 model B16 would have the 160bhp version.
my engine is out of a 1993 civic vti, and it has 160bhp, so i should be ok. if the engine is still in the car see if you can have a drive, cos these engines have a week syncro mesh in 5th gear. change at highest possible revs to see if it crunches etc, if it does then replace it before you put it in the mini cos living with double clutching is not fun.

Hi MiniTec
I 've rebuild an Y2 gearbox last week because the sync 3/4/5 was broken..
It 's not that hard to replace the parts..
Honda Partnr # 23626-PS1-315 is fifth Sync set €97
Honda Partnr # 23623-PY1-E00 is third and fourth Sync set €142
